Who will win Mississippi vs Auburn?

The Auburn Tigers are the No. 2 team in the country per KenPom and the NET rankings. Despite losing their final two games, they still have a 27-4 record and went 15-4 in Quad 1 games.

All four of Auburn's losses came against ranked opponents and the Ole Miss Rebels fell out of the rankings after a rough end to their regular season.

The Rebels went 6-9 against Quad 1 foes and lost by double-digits to Auburn twice since the start of February. The Tigers are 11.5-point favorites for good reason and should be able to cruise to victory here. 

Mississippi vs Auburn prediction

My best bet: Auburn -11.5 (-110 at bet365)

There has to be some concern that teams on a double-bye might start slow due to the layoff. That said, fatigue also plays a factor for teams on a back-to-back and Auburn has too many matchup advantages for me to bet against them here. 

The Tigers have looked like an elite team all season and defeated Ole Miss twice over the last month and a half. They beat the Rebels 92-82 when these teams clashed in Oxford on February 1 before destroying them by 30 points in The Jungle on February 26.  

The Tigers dropped their final two games of the regular season, losing at Texas A&M and falling in an OT thriller to Alabama. That said, I almost like them more for that reason. Sometimes the best thing for a title contender is to lose a game or two near the end of the regular season as a reminder that they're not invincible and need to be focused for tournament season. 

Ole Miss also stumbled into the postseason, going 7-7 straight up and 2-11-1 against the spread in its last 14 games. Since the start of February, the Rebels are dead-last in the SEC in adjusted defensive efficiency which is bad news against an Auburn attack that is first in the country in adjusted offense. 

Mississippi's biggest strength has been its ball pressure (35th in opponent turnover rate) but Auburn turns the ball over at the fourth-lowest rate in the country.

The Rebels' most glaring weakness is on the glass where they sit outside the Top 300 in rebounding rate (46.9%). They have one of the smaller lineups among high-major schools and will struggle against a long and athletic Tigers squad that is 50th in rebounding rate (52.8%) and 12th at attacking the rim per ShotQualityBets.
